  4. Outburst By McCarthy Against U.S. President

    WASHINGTON, Wed.-- Wisconsin Republican Senator Joseph McCarthy yesterday accused President Eisenhower of congratulating those who delay exposure of Communists and, at the same time, urging tolerance "to those who are torturing American uniformed men." ...

  6. WIDESPREAD POINTERS TO TALKS WITH SOVIET

    WASHINGTON, Wed.--The United States Ambassador to Russia (Mr. Charles Bohlen), who was recalled briefly to Washington last week, will seek more informal talks with the Soviet leaders after his return to his Moscow post today. ...
